摘要
Effects of the Leslie viscosity coefficients alpha(i) (i=1, 2, ..., 5) of nematic liquid crystals (NLCs) with negative dielectric anisotropy (Delta epsilon<0) on the electric-field-induced director reorientation in homeotropic NLC cells have been studied from the analysis of the transient current induced by step voltage application. The transient current in a homeotropic NLC cell with Delta epsilon<0 was well reproduced by computer simulation, based on the theory of NLCs in which the flow effects and the free-slip boundary condition are taken into account. It is found that the response time of vertical alignment NLC displays is dominantly governed by alpha(2) and alpha(4) + alpha(5) of NLCs with Delta epsilon<0. (C) 2008 Elsevier B.V.
